Jammu , 02 Feb 2018

Governor N.N. Vohra inaugurated the “66th B.N. Mullik Memorial All India Police Football Championship-2017” here today. This Championship, being hosted by the J&K Police has attracted 37 teams from all over India which comprise nearly 1000 football players who will participate in this 11 day tournament. Syed Basharat Ahmed Bukhari, Minister for Horticulture, Sh. Nazir Ahmad Laway, Member of Parliament and a large number of serving and retired Police officers and other invitees were present on the occasion.Welcoming the participating teams on this happy occasion, Governor observed that besides working long hours to maintain law and order our policemen are also doing extremely well in various games and sports. He lauded the J&K Police for their devotion to duty and for their achievements in various sports competitions in the country.

Governor suggested to Dr. S.P. Vaid, DGP J&K, to invite school boys and girls to witness the final rounds of matches in this Championship so that they can both enjoy watching well contested matches and also be inspired to participate in sports. He called upon the youth to take an active part in sports besides attending to their studies.On his arrival, Governor was introduced to the Jury of Appeal, Organizing Committee and Managers of the 37 participating teams which took part in the March Past.The Welcome Speech was given by Dr. S.P. Vaid, DGP, J&K and the Vote of Thanks was given by Sh. A.K. Choudhary, ADGP Armed.
